National Museum of Mongolia, National history museum in Sükhbaatar, Mongolia

The National Museum of Mongolia is a major museum in Ulaanbaatar that holds a large collection of objects from different periods of Mongolian history. The exhibitions spread across multiple sections and display artifacts ranging from prehistoric times to the modern era.

The museum was founded in 1924 as a government institution and expanded its collections over time to become the country's main keeper of historical objects. It gradually grew and developed into the primary place for preserving Mongolia's past.

The museum displays traditional clothing, jewelry, and religious objects from different eras that show how people lived in Mongolia and expressed their identity. These items reveal the values and daily practices of nomadic communities across the centuries.

The museum is located in central Ulaanbaatar and is easily accessible by public transport, with signage to help guide visitors. You should allow enough time to explore the different exhibition areas comfortably.

The museum preserves ancient deer stones, stone monuments from around 1000 BCE that document early human settlements in the Mongolian steppes. These rare monuments offer insight into a little-known phase of regional archaeology.
